Output bb58c6306afc27e8c3ed5bea1487bcb5bfed60652c3b47105fc09b7aaf03d30e:70

value
2626
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c3c14ecf22151d68a2af2d3414c3ed5373eaf961b8d1b071d9aaf3995fe2a65d
address
bc1pc0q5anezz5wk3g40956pfsld2de747tphrgmquwe4teejhlz5ewse4mtcm
transaction
bb58c6306afc27e8c3ed5bea1487bcb5bfed60652c3b47105fc09b7aaf03d30e